Description: Wikimedia Commons is a media repository containing over 60 million freely usable media files. It provides a centralized location to store and share images, videos, sounds, and other files for use in educational and creative projects.

Description: Morguefile.com is a free photo sharing website where photographers can upload their work to be used by others royalty-free. It features over 350,000 high-resolution stock photos that can be downloaded without charge and used for commercial or personal purposes.
